What boats do we sail?

For training in Barcelona we use J/70 and Laser racing sailboats.

 

 

J/70 is a modern keelboat designed for a crew of 3–4 people. Fast, maneuverable, stable and safe. It is ideal for team training, sparring sessions and participation in regattas.

Laser is a single-handed Olympic class dinghy. It is perfect for individual training, helping sailors develop technique, balance and sensitivity to the wind.

 

This format allows participants to train both as a team and individually, depending on their goals and level of experience.

Training and Practice in Barcelona

We organize regular training sessions and sailing practice on the water. The formats are adapted to the participants’ level.

 

• Regular Training — 2.5 hours of practice on the water with a professional instructor. Includes:

– practicing maneuvers and sail handling

– start procedures and tacks/gybes

– a short theoretical debrief after the session

 

• Beginner Training — first introduction to the boat, basic maneuvers and sailing fundamentals.

 

• Sparring Session — training between two experienced crews.

 

• Beginner Course on J/70 — a structured sailing course from zero including theory and homework assignments. Course duration: 4 days.

 

• Individual Laser Training — focused work on sailing technique and speed.

What else can you learn from us?

In Barcelona, we also prepare future skippers for the IYT international license.

 

The main program is the Stage 1 Captain's Course.

 

This is the first step toward an international skipper's certificate, where you will master the fundamentals of sailing yacht handling: sail management, basic navigation, right-of-way rules, safety, and radio communications.

 

The course is suitable for both beginners and those with experience who want to systematize their knowledge and move on to seafaring practice and training for the IYT Bareboat Skipper Sail license.
